High price of cancer-fighting medication forces patients to use India-made medicine

As the majority of cancer-curing medications are expensive, most patients are relying on medicine imported from India, cancer specialist Dr. Soe Aung told a health forum on eliminating cancer through education.

“On the patients’ side, they ask for the best medicine. One brand-name medicine was imported from India by three or four companies. Here in Myanmar, we have to use all the imported medicines. We don’t know for sure which medicine is the best,” said Dr. Soe Aung.

He added that the Myanmar Food and Drug Control Department needs to check the quality of food and medicine imported.

Moreover, storefront medicine shops opening on township streets should be subjected to occasional surprise checks.

By using certain cancer medicines, patients can destroy some cancer cells. As more remedies for cancer treatment have emerged, many cancers can at least be managed if not completely cured.

Myanmar imported more than US$ 150 million (Ks 145.79 billion) worth of medicine in the 2009-2010 financial year. For the 2012-13 financial year, that figure has increased to more than US$ 244 million.
